Benefits of Property Investing in Bali vs Other Countries

To understand Bali's unique position, it's essential to compare it directly with other global property hotspots. While each market has its allure, the numbers reveal a compelling story about risk, reward, and return on investment.

From the bustling streets of Dubai to the serene shores of Phuket, here is how the Island of the Gods compares.

LocationAvg Rental Yield (Gross)Annual AppreciationMin Entry Price (USD)Avg Occupancy
Bali8-12%5-10%$200,00060%
Phuket6-10%5-10%$150,00070%
Da Nang4-6%4-7%$100,00060%
Sydney2.5-3%4-6%$500,00095%
Dubai6-8%5-8%$200,00085%
London4.5-5.5%3-5%$400,00092%
Paris3-4%1-3%$450,00090%

Source: bambooroutes.com, reloc8phuket.com, realestate.com.au, engelvoelkers.com, investropa.com

The Pros of Investing in These Places

  • Bali (Indonesia): High rental yields, strong tourism, relatively affordable, vibrant lifestyle

  • Phuket (Thailand): Established tourism market, strong rental demand, well-developed infrastructure

  • Da Nang (Vietnam): Emerging market with growth potential, affordable property prices, government investment in infrastructure

  • Sydney (Australia): Strong legal framework, political and economic stability, high quality of life

  • Dubai (UAE): Tax-free income, high rental yields, booming economy, strong investor protections

  • London (UK): Highly liquid market, strong legal system, global financial hub, stable long-term growth

  • Paris (France): Strong long-term value, high cultural appeal, stable rental market

The Cons of Investing in These Places

  • Bali (Indonesia): Complex foreign ownership laws, potential for market volatility, infrastructure challenges

  • Phuket (Thailand): Stricter foreign ownership regulations, potential for oversupply in some areas, currency fluctuations

  • Da Nang (Vietnam): Developing legal framework, less mature market, currency convertibility issues

  • Sydney (Australia): High property prices, lower rental yields, complex tax system

  • Dubai (UAE): High cost of living, market can be sensitive to oil prices and regional geopolitics, hot climate

  • London (UK): Extremely high property prices, lower rental yields, high transaction costs

  • Paris (France): High property prices, complex bureaucracy, tenant-friendly rental laws can be challenging for landlords

Core Benefits of Bali Property Investment

The data clearly highlights Bali's primary advantage: an exceptional potential for high returns.

An average rental yield of 8-12% is almost unheard of in mature Western markets, making the island a magnet for those focused on cash flow and a strong ROI.

This is driven by several core factors:

  • Booming Tourism: Bali is a world-renowned travel destination. This constant influx of tourists creates a robust and high-demand vacation rental market, particularly in hotspots like Canggu, Seminyak, and the rapidly growing Bukit Uluwatu Peninsula, which includes Uluwatu and Bingin.

  • Affordable Entry Point: The cost of acquiring a luxury villa in Bali is a fraction of what a small apartment would cost in London or Sydney. This accessibility allows a wider range of investors to enter the market and acquire properties with significant rental potential. It's crucial for investors to understand what they can get for their budget, as even a modest investment can yield a high-quality asset.

  • Lifestyle Appeal: Investors aren't just buying a property; they're buying into a lifestyle. The island's rich culture, stunning natural beauty, and vibrant expatriate community create an environment that attracts long-term renters and digital nomads, bolstering the demand for various rental strategies beyond short-term tourism.

  • Capital Appreciation: Beyond rental income, emerging areas across South Bali are showing strong signs of capital appreciation as infrastructure improves and new hotspots are established.
